Bryce Johnson
Bryce Johnson
Inclusive Designer
Microsoft Devices
Bryce is an inclusive designer for Microsoft Devices where he is devoted to ensuring Microsoft products are accessible. Bryce initiated and designed the Inclusive Tech Lab at Microsoft, which has now hosted over fifteen thousand visitors; it is a facility where people can explore how people with disabilities interact with Microsoft products and services.

Katrina Alcorn
Katrina Alcorn
Global Product Design Executive
Katrina Alcorn is a global product design executive and award-winning author. She has built the UX practice at Hot Studio, a boutique agency that was acquired by Facebook, and then at Autodesk, where she centralized the digital design and research teams and her team's work led to a 5x increase in global ecommerce. Most recently, Katrina led one of the world’s largest design practices at IBM.
